Scope of the Patent: Structural and Functional Claims

Core Structural Claims

The core of PA8542901 is expected to involve a chemical structure claim, specifying the molecular framework, substitutions, stereochemistry, and functional groups. Such claims typically read as:

"A chemical compound comprising [core structure], wherein [specific substitutions or stereochemistry]."

The scope here is primarily chemical, focusing on compounds with certain structural features. The breadth depends on whether the claims are narrowly tailored (covering specific derivatives) or broader (covering entire classes of compounds).

Implication:

  • Narrow claims limit the scope, reducing risk of invalidation but also limiting enforceability.
  • Broad claims improve market exclusivity but are more vulnerable to validity challenges, such as lack of novelty or inventive step.

Functional and Method Claims

Beyond chemical entities, the patent likely includes claims related to:

  • Pharmaceutical formulations: Specific dosage forms, excipients, or delivery mechanisms.
  • Method of use: Therapeutic methods for treating diseases linked to the active compound.
  • Process claims: Methods of synthesizing the compound.

Implication:
Method claims typically expand patent scope by protecting specific manufacturing procedures or use scenarios.
